Catastrophe losses may outweigh pandemic for U.S. P&C insurers in H2 2020: Fitch

In the second-half of 2020, while impacts from the COVID-19 pandemic continue for the U.S. property and casualty (P&C) insurance space, carriers may find themselves more impacted by losses from recent and continuing catastrophe events, Fitch Ratings has said. Pandemic-related insured losses and premium volume declines caused by the economic situation will continue to adversely…

Kerrisdale: AtriCure Inc. (ATRC) Revenue Growth is Set to Short-Circuit

Kerrisdale Capital is short shares of AtriCure, Inc. Q2 2020 hedge fund letters, conferences and more We are short shares of AtriCure, a $1.9bn medical device company that manufactures and sells ablation equipment used in the surgical treatment of atrial fibrillation (AF). At about 7x forward revenues, AtriCure’s valuation implies that the company’s outlook is […]
